Attempted abduction in Niagara

Niagara police are hunting for a man who tried to drag a young woman into his car last night. The attempted abduction happened near downtown St. Catharines. The young woman was shaken up by the ordeal, but wasn’t seriously hurt.

Just after nine last night, a 20 year old woman was walking eastbound on Division Street near Riordan when a man in a smaller, tan, four-door car pulled up and blocked the woman’s path on the sidewalk near an apartment building.

He then opened the door and got out of the driver’s seat.

The male approached her and took hold of her and tried to drag her towards that vehicle and a short struggle ensured–she was able to get away uninjured.

The woman then ran to a nearby home and banged on the door. She told the person who answered the door what happened and they called the police.

Meanwhile, the man who grabbed the woman fled in his car. He turned right on Calvin Street heading toward gale crescent.

The man is in his 50’s. He has an olive complexion and is average height with a thin face and slender build.
He has short receding grey hair, a neatly trimmed grey moustache and spoke with a possible middle eastern accent.

Police have been searching for the car and the attempted abductor since the incident.

Women in the neighbourhood are nervous.

“I’ve only lived here for a few weeks. I’ve heard of things going down on Division Street, I just didn’t expect anything like this.”

Police are advising residents to be more aware of what’s going on around them.
